Output e6089e42ad5a0aedc973c7932fb9a34b6ba56483cae0defcd756c89eaa88d100:3

value
103178907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b69a346066c2ae01e59e4d74108b55d50de86a6e OP_EQUAL
address
MQYfwfcKGYM2q6Z6AEH2u1JG7CFUWqtpzm
transaction
e6089e42ad5a0aedc973c7932fb9a34b6ba56483cae0defcd756c89eaa88d100
spent
true